Output d381898a6f8dcfda7ae5f63c3e4a3aae1c0222aeee27034c3cdb6dd3166d6b95:0

value
59012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b8c592e2907f35443a7e7cd91789961416d0ff OP_EQUAL
address
3FA6bumgKfmXscuq4QNzdyMgUXhn4gEssk
transaction
d381898a6f8dcfda7ae5f63c3e4a3aae1c0222aeee27034c3cdb6dd3166d6b95
spent
true